如何操作 `nopowershell`:一个无 PowerShell 的 Windows 管理工具指南

如何操作 nopowershell:一个无 PowerShell 的 Windows 管理工具指南

nopowershellPowerShell rebuilt in C# for Red Teaming purposes项目地址:https://gitcode.com/gh_mirrors/no/nopowershell


项目简介

nopowershell 是一个专为那些寻求在不使用 PowerShell 情况下管理 Windows 系统的开发者和系统管理员设计的开源工具。它提供了一种替代方案来执行常见的系统管理任务,尤其是在环境限制或安全性要求高的场景中。


1. 项目目录结构及介绍

nopowershell/
│
├── src                # 主要源代码存放目录
│   ├── main.cpp       # 应用程序入口点
│   └── ...            # 其他源文件和辅助模块
├── include            # 头文件目录,包含项目所需的接口定义
│   └── nopowershell.h # 主头文件,声明关键类和函数
├── CMakeLists.txt     # CMake 构建配置文件
└── README.md          # 项目说明文件,快速了解和起步指引

此结构非常典型,源码位于 src 目录下,所有编译时依赖的头文件则置于 include 中。CMake脚本用于跨平台构建过程的配置。


2. 项目的启动文件介绍

启动文件主要指的是 src/main.cpp。在这个文件里,您会找到应用程序的入口点,即 main() 函数。这个函数是程序启动时最先执行的地方,负责初始化、调用核心功能逻辑以及处理程序结束前的清理工作。对于 nopowershell 项目而言,这将包括加载配置、初始化系统交互逻辑等关键步骤,虽然具体实现细节需查看源码以获得详尽理解。


3. 项目的配置文件介绍

由于提供的链接仅指向GitHub仓库而没有详细说明具体的配置文件细节,通常情况下,一个基于C++且利用外部配置的应用可能会有一个或多个配置文件。但在此特定项目中,没有直接提及配置文件的存在。若参照常见开源软件惯例,配置信息可能嵌入在代码中或者通过命令行参数传递给程序。若需外部配置,预期会在项目的根目录下或特定子目录中添加.ini.json.yaml格式的文件,并应在项目文档或源码注释中进行说明。

考虑到上述信息是从项目通用结构和常规实践推断而来,实际配置方式需依据项目最新版本的文档或源码分析确定。如果项目内存在特定配置文件,请查阅源码或README.md中的相关指导部分。


请注意,由于无法直接访问或解析该GitHub仓库的实时内容,上述目录结构和文件介绍是基于典型的开源软件组织形式和假设。务必参考仓库内的实际文件和文档获取最准确的信息。

nopowershellPowerShell rebuilt in C# for Red Teaming purposes项目地址:https://gitcode.com/gh_mirrors/no/nopowershell

  • 2
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

乔或婵

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值